India's merchandise exports touched a record $420 billion in FY22. It took a decade for India to incrementally add another $100 billion (the $300 billion mark was touched in FY12) as against reaching $200 billion from $100 billion in only 5 years (FY06 to FY11).

India has recorded a significant rise in junk-food — especially packaged and processed food over the last two decades. This has led to an adverse effect on public health as most of these foods contain high amounts of sugar or salt and bad fat ingredients that results in increased obesity as well as conditions like diabetes and heart disease.

 Start-ups in India have raised $7.2 billion in Q1 CY22, a substantial increase from $4.5 billion in Q1 CY21, a joint report by industry body NASSCOM and PGA Labs stated. Even as the deal volume increased to 247 transactions in Q1 CY22 across the ecosystem as compared to 175 in a year ago period.

 Cryptocurrency markets have witnessed a downtrend in the last 24 hours. The global market cap is down by 2.58 per cent in the last 24 hours and is at $1.88 trillion as of 8:00 AM IST, CoinMarketCap data showed.
